public void FormDaftarNotaBeli_Load(object sender, EventArgs e) { comboBoxCari.Items.AddRange(new string[] { "No Nota", "ID Supplier", "Nama Supplier", "Alamat Supplier", "Diskon", "Total Harga", "Batas Pelunasan", "Batas Diskon", "Tanggal Pembelian", "Status", "Keterangan" }); this.Location = new Point(0, 0); comboBoxCari.DropDownStyle = ComboBoxStyle.DropDownList; FormatDataGrid(); string hasilBaca = NotaPembelian.BacaData("", "", listHasilData); if (hasilBaca == "1") { dataGridViewNota.Rows.Clear(); for (int i = 0; i < listHasilData.Count; i++) { string total = listHasilData[i].TotalHarga.ToString("RP 0,###"); dataGridViewNota.Rows.Add(listHasilData[i].NoNotaPembelian, listHasilData[i].Supplier.IdSupplier, listHasilData[i].Supplier.Nama, listHasilData[i].Supplier.Alamat, listHasilData[i].Diskon, total, listHasilData[i].TglBatasPelunasan.ToString("dddd, dd MMMM yyyy"), listHasilData[i].TglBatasDiskon.ToString("dddd, dd MMMM yyyy"), listHasilData[i].TglBeli.ToString("dddd, dd MMMM yyyy"), listHasilData[i].Status, listHasilData[i].Keterangan); } } }
private void FormTambahPenerimaan_Load(object sender, EventArgs e) { comboBoxJenisPengiriman.Items.AddRange(new string[] { "Shipping Point", "Destination Point" }); string noNotaBaru; textBoxIdPengiriman.Enabled = false; dateTimePickerTerima.Enabled = false; dateTimePickerTerima.Value = DateTime.Now; comboBoxNoNotaBeli.DropDownStyle = ComboBoxStyle.DropDownList; comboBoxJenisPengiriman.DropDownStyle = ComboBoxStyle.DropDownList; string hasilGenerate = Penerimaan.GenerateNoNota(out noNotaBaru); textBoxIdPengiriman.Clear(); if (hasilGenerate == "1") { textBoxIdPengiriman.Text = noNotaBaru; } else { MessageBox.Show("Gagal melakukan generate code. Pesan kesalahan: " + hasilGenerate); } string hasilBaca = NotaPembelian.BacaData("", "", listHasilNota); if (hasilBaca == "1") { comboBoxNoNotaBeli.Items.Clear(); for (int i = 0; i < listHasilNota.Count; i++) { comboBoxNoNotaBeli.Items.Add(listHasilNota[i].NoNotaPembelian); } } else { comboBoxNoNotaBeli.Items.Clear(); } if (comboBoxNoNotaBeli.Items.Count != 0) { comboBoxNoNotaBeli.SelectedIndex = 0; } comboBoxJenisPengiriman.SelectedIndex = 0; FormUtama form = (FormUtama)this.Owner.MdiParent; labelKodePgw.Text = form.labelKodePgw.Text; labelNamaPgw.Text = form.labelNamaPgw.Text; }
private void comboBoxCari_TextChanged(object sender, EventArgs e) { string hasilBaca = NotaPembelian.BacaData("", "", listHasilData); if (hasilBaca == "1") { dataGridViewNota.Rows.Clear(); for (int i = 0; i < listHasilData.Count; i++) { string total = listHasilData[i].TotalHarga.ToString("RP 0,###"); dataGridViewNota.Rows.Add(listHasilData[i].NoNotaPembelian, listHasilData[i].Supplier.IdSupplier, listHasilData[i].Supplier.Nama, listHasilData[i].Supplier.Alamat, listHasilData[i].Diskon, total, listHasilData[i].TglBatasPelunasan.ToString("dddd, dd MMMM yyyy"), listHasilData[i].TglBatasDiskon.ToString("dddd, dd MMMM yyyy"), listHasilData[i].TglBeli.ToString("dddd, dd MMMM yyyy"), listHasilData[i].Status, listHasilData[i].Keterangan); } } }
private void buttonCari_Click(object sender, EventArgs e) { string nilaiKriteria = textBoxCari.Text; if (comboBoxCari.Text == "No Nota") { kriteria = "noNotaPembelian"; } else if (comboBoxCari.Text == "ID Supplier") { kriteria = "idSupplier"; } else if (comboBoxCari.Text == "Nama Supplier") { kriteria = "namaSupplier"; } else if (comboBoxCari.Text == "Alamat Supplier") { kriteria = "alamatSupplier"; } else if (comboBoxCari.Text == "Diskon") { kriteria = "diskon"; } else if (comboBoxCari.Text == "Total Harga") { kriteria = "totalHarga"; } else if (comboBoxCari.Text == "Batas Pelunasan") { kriteria = "tglBatasPelunasan"; } else if (comboBoxCari.Text == "Batas Diskon") { kriteria = "tglBatasDiskon"; } else if (comboBoxCari.Text == "Tanggal Pembelian") { kriteria = "tglBeli"; } else if (comboBoxCari.Text == "Status") { kriteria = "status"; } else if (comboBoxCari.Text == "Keterangan") { kriteria = "keterangan"; } string hasilBaca = NotaPembelian.BacaData(kriteria, nilaiKriteria, listHasilData); if (hasilBaca == "1") { dataGridViewNota.Rows.Clear(); for (int i = 0; i < listHasilData.Count; i++) { string total = listHasilData[i].TotalHarga.ToString("RP 0,###"); dataGridViewNota.Rows.Add(listHasilData[i].NoNotaPembelian, listHasilData[i].Supplier.IdSupplier, listHasilData[i].Supplier.Nama, listHasilData[i].Supplier.Alamat, listHasilData[i].Diskon, total, listHasilData[i].TglBatasPelunasan.ToString("dddd, dd MMMM yyyy"), listHasilData[i].TglBatasDiskon.ToString("dddd, dd MMMM yyyy"), listHasilData[i].TglBeli.ToString("dddd, dd MMMM yyyy"), listHasilData[i].Status, listHasilData[i].Keterangan); } } }